Comfort Food Recipes

Annie B. Copps

So much more than just fuel for our bodies, food can also give great pleasure and solace. Sometimes it's the act of cooking that comforts; the methodical pace of chopping and slicing offers a primal, satisfying rhythm that connects us to ourselves. Sometimes it's cooking with and for others that restores calm. Other times still, it's a pint of butter-brickle ice cream eaten on the couch with a spoon, feeding not just our physiological needs but our very souls.
